Pricing Considerations and Value Factors
What Influes Cost and Transparency
Pricing for Harry Private Jet services reflects aircraft category, trip distance, and operational expenses such as crew positioning and overnight fees. Published rate cards often exclude taxes and surcharges, so final invoices can vary. Clients seeking predictability may explore management programs or block hours where applicable. The following table summarizes common cost drivers and how they affect the overall trip price.
| Cost Driver | Impact on Price | Notes for Clients |
|---|---|---|
| Aircraft Size | Higher direct operating costs | Larger cabins command premium rates |
| Trip Distance | Fuel and time-based charges | Longer legs increase base price |
| Airport Fees | Landing and handling fees | Smaller airports may have lower fees |
| Positioning Legs | Empty repositioning costs | Can be baked into published rates |

How to Verify Operator Details
Steps for Confirming Legitimacy and Safety
Before booking, travelers can take practical steps to confirm alignment with their expectations. Request the name of the operating carrier, air operator certificate number, and insurance documentation. Cross-reference aircraft registration when possible, and confirm maintenance status and crew qualifications. These steps help reduce risk and support a smoother travel experience.
